Ochotto Lake comes in at a B on the grading rubric — a respectable showing for a Minnesota lake of its size and depth.
Mesotrophic conditions dominate at Ochotto Lake: enough nutrients for a healthy fishery, not so much that algal blooms become a chronic problem. A maximum depth of 40 ft puts Ochotto Lake in the middle of Minnesota's depth distribution. Ochotto Lake is small — 40 acres alongside 1.2 miles of shoreline — which makes it sensitive to even modest changes in watershed runoff or recreational pressure. Ochotto Lake ranks 19 of 55 in Stearns County — solidly in the upper half of the local distribution.
No invasive species are currently listed at Ochotto Lake — the lake remains off the Minnesota infested-waters roster. The fishery is bass-led, with 7 documented species across the lake's records. A documented public access point at Ochotto Lake makes the lake usable for shore fishing, paddle craft, and trailered boats. The lake has a partial ice record — 5 observed ice-outs, centered near Apr 7. The grade is based on limited monitoring — fewer than three independent measurement years contribute, so future updates may shift the letter.

DNR Fisheries Survey Summary
5 surveys on file from MN DNR Fisheries. Most recent: 2012-07-09 (Standard Survey).
Top Species by Catch Rate
| Species | Avg CPUE | Avg Weight |
|---|---|---|
| Largemouth Bass | 20.83 | 0.95 lb |
| Bluegill | 13.45 | 0.14 lb |
| Yellow Bass | 11.44 | 0.7 lb |
| Black Bullhead | 7.83 | 0.53 lb |
| Northern Pike | 6.89 | 1.57 lb |
| Pumpkinseed | 4.57 | 0.13 lb |
CPUE = catch per unit effort, averaged across surveys (excludes juvenile shoreline seining). Higher CPUE = more abundant in standardized sampling.

From the 2012-07-09 survey
Ochotto Lake is located in Stearns County, near Avon. The lake has a surface area of 40 acres and a maximum depth of 40 feet. The watershed is very small and mostly residential and agriculture.
